site stats

Spi_clock_polarity

WebFeb 4, 2024 · SPI is used to communicate with devices such as EEPROMs, real-time clocks, converters (ADC and DAC), and sensors. The SPI bus is a four-wire, full-duplex serial interface. SPI specifies four signals, clock (SCLK), master output, slave input (MOSI); master input, slave output (MISO); and chip/slave select (SS). Webreceived data from the slave is sampled on the rising edge of the clock. With negative clock polarity, the master (eTPU SPI) changes the transmitted data on the rising edge of the clock. The received data from the slave is sampled on the falling edge of the clock. Figure 1. SPI Timing when CLK has Positive Polarity Data Out 1/baud_rate Data In ...

Basics of SPI - openlabpro.com

WebNov 18, 2024 · Serial Peripheral Interface (SPI) is a synchronous serial data protocol used by microcontrollers for communicating with one or more peripheral devices quickly over … WebSelect spi or clock syn mode operation. spi_communication_t: spi_comm: Select full-duplex or transmit-only communication. spi_ssl_polarity_t: ssl_polarity: Select SSLn signal polarity. spi_ssl_select_t: ssl_select: Select which slave to use: 0-SSL0, 1-SSL1, 2-SSL2, 3-SSL3. spi_mosi_idle_value_fixing_t: mosi_idle: Select MOSI idle fixed value ... hough crewe cheshire https://hortonsolutions.com

SPI Devices CircuitPython I2C and SPI Under the …

WebOct 24, 2024 · Setting up the SPI peripheral is relatively straightforward, requiring the configuration of the clock and parameters such as 8- or 16-bit transfers. Less obvious are the SPI clock polarity (CPOL ... WebApr 30, 2024 · SPI Modes – Clock Polarity & Phase. We already seen that clock for data transfer is ... WebMar 8, 2024 · // CPOL: Clock Polarity // CPOL=0 means clock idles at 0, leading edge is rising edge. // CPOL=1 means clock idles at 1, leading edge is falling edge. assign w_CPOL = (SPI_MODE == 2) (SPI_MODE == 3 ); // CPHA: Clock Phase // CPHA=0 means the "out" side changes the data on trailing edge of clock hough day trips

Overview of Linux kernel SPI support

Category:Clock Phase and Polarity USB-I2C/SPI/GPIO Interface Adapters

Tags:Spi_clock_polarity

Spi_clock_polarity

Back to Basics: SPI (Serial Peripheral Interface)

Webpolarity can be 0 or 1, and is the level the idle clock line sits at. phase can be 0 or 1 to sample data on the first or second clock edge respectively. bits can be 8 or 16, and is the number of bits in each transferred word. firstbit can be SPI.MSB or SPI.LSB. ti True indicates Texas Instruments, as opposed to Motorola, signal conventions. crc ... Web1. SPI-- there are four possibilities of clock polarity and phase, all of which have been used at one time or another. There is no real standard in one place, just a defacto standard. …

Spi_clock_polarity

Did you know?

WebJul 22, 2014 · Typically the device has a register with bits corresponding to clock phase and polarity. Some chips may implement an SPI-like 3-wire protocol that is not configurable, … WebClock phase determines when data is transmitted relative to the clock. It’s value also depends on clock polarity, both of these parameters creates different modes in SPI. Based on the clock polarity and clock phase, there are four modes that can be used in an SPI protocol. If the clock phase is 0, the data is latched at the rising edge of the ...

WebThe SPI.setDataMode() function lets you set the mode to control clock polarity and phase. Every SPI device has a maximum allowed speed for SPI Bus. The SPI.setClockDivider() allows you to change the clock speed to make your device working properly (default is 4MHz). Once you have your SPI parameters set correctly you just need to figure which ... WebApr 19, 2024 · Switch SPI Clock Polarity Before Receive. taboteke over 5 years ago. I am interfacing nrf52832 with TI TRF7960A using SDK 14.2.0. According to Application Report …

WebJul 6, 2024 · New to using HAL, and I'm having several issues with setting up the SPI. I'm using SPI 1 on an STM32F429ZGT6. Here's my setup: SPI_HandleTypeDef SPI_1; void … WebThe SPI interface bus is straightforward and versatile, enabling simple and fast communication with a variety of peripherals. A high speed multi-IO mode host adapter like the Corelis BusPro-S can be an invaluable tool in …

WebSPI_CLOCK_POLARITY_IDLE_LOW = 0 << SPI_CSR_CPOL_Pos, SPI_CLOCK_POLARITY_IDLE_HIGH = 1 << SPI_CSR_CPOL_Pos, /* Force the compiler to reserve 32-bit space for each enum value */ SPI_CLOCK_POLARITY_INVALID = 0xFFFFFFFF}SPI_CLOCK_POLARITY; typedef enum

Web本文将介绍如何使用STM32CubeMX配置STM32微控制器的SPI通信,并使用W25Q64闪存和NRF24L01无线模块进行通信。 1. 配置SPI 首先,打开STM32CubeMX软件,选择你的STM32微控制器型号,并创建一个新的工程。 ... 然后,将“Data Size”设置为“8 bits”,“Clock Polarity”设置为“Low ... hough definition bibleWebOct 16, 2013 · 1. Clocks don't generally have an active "level" per say; in many cases clock outputs will specify that they'll only stop when they're at a certain level, but otherwise clocks have active edges. Typically, SPI devices will use one clock edge as a signal to output each bit of data, and the following clock edge as a signal that to latch the data ... hough definedWebFeb 13, 2024 · Clock Polarity and Phase Clock transitions govern the shifting and sampling of data. SPI has four modes (0,1,2,3) that correspond to the four possible clocking … linkedin v2 socialactionsWebMay 23, 2024 · The clock polarity determines whether the clock line idles high or low. These parameters must be determined based on when the slave device is expecting data to be … linkedin val walsh microsoftWebThe master configures the clock polarity (CPOL) and clock phase (CPHA) to correspond to slave device requirements. These parameters determine when the data must be stable, … hough dancingWebWe can initialize the SPI port clock polarity by :- SPI_InitStruct.SPI_CPOL = SPI_CPOL_Low; SPI_InitStruct.SPI_CPHA = SPI_CPHA_1Edge; If we have several slaves connected to the … hough dance showWebSep 26, 2015 · Clock phase and polarity. There are four way you can sample the SPI clock. The SPI protocol allows for variations on the polarity of the clock pulses. CPOL is clock polarity, and CPHA is clock phase. Mode 0 (the default) - clock is normally low (CPOL = 0), and the data is sampled on the transition from low to high (leading edge) (CPHA = 0) hough dancing tour 2017